Pilot Season 2024 launches on Friday, May 24th. Pilot Season is a unique annual campaign launched in 2023 in the UK by Unedited. It aims to engage the British audio production industry in entrepreneurial collaboration by showcasing original intellectual property, formats and narratives. In its second year, five companies joined forces to promote creative collaboration: Breaking Atoms, Kingtown, Mags Creative, Reduced Listening and Unedited.     The remarkable true story of Sarah Rector (1902 – 1967). Born in servitude to Native AmericansSarah becomes the first black child millionaire.     Redemption Man is a six-part audio documentary about the mysterious man who has been seen carrying a large white cross throughout West London for almost 35 years. Then he disappeared.So, who was Redemption Man?The series uncovers the life and legacy of the Redemption Man, illuminating lesser-known yet crucial aspects of black history in London post-Windrush.
